Large early 20th century vintage Colman's enamel shop display advertising sign. Vintage vinyl rack Depth: 23cmVery early Colmans Starch large and heavy blue and white porcelain enamel sign. Made for Colmans by Benjamin Baugh, who opened one of the first enamel sign factories in the late 19th century The Patent Enamel Company Ltd in Selly Oak, Birmingham. Im guessing the 2 11 is February 1911. In excellent condition, with just some light corrosion to the edges and some surface areas see the photos for more details. DIMENSIONS: 92cm x 61cm DELIVERY: Options
